An excellent result is greater than 2.50 meters for men (8' 2.5") and 2.00 meters for women (6' 6.75").What is the average long jump for a 13 year old?
found that the standing long jump values in 11- year-old boys were 166.5±20.6 cm, and those values in girls were 157.5±20.2 cm. Standing long jump values in 12- year-old boys were 174.6±17.8 cm and they were 161.4±20.6 cm in girls. The same value was 182.4±22.1 cm in 13- year-old boys and 169.6±20.6 cm for girls.How do parkour jump so high?

February 23, 2015: UConn CB Byron Jones sets a world record with a 12'3" broad jump at the NFL Scouting Combine.What is the longest standing long jump?
The current record is held by Byron Jones, who recorded a jump of 3.73 m ( 12 ft 23⁄4 in) at the NFL Combine on February 23, 2015, beating the competition world record of 3.71 m (12 ft 2 in) set by Norwegian shot putter Arne Tvervaag from Ringerike FIK Sportclub in 1968.What is a good NFL broad jump?

Lower your body. If you are trying to escape from a window and you can avoid jumping, it is best to hold onto the windowsill or ledge, lower yourself to arms length, and drop from there. This will shorten the distance between you and the ground and therefore, reduce the impact.What is the world record for middle school long jump?
